Born in 1994, Ophélie Demurger graduated from ENSBA Lyon in 2018. Through performances, installations and videos, she works on issues of incarnation and our relations to one another. Playing on her status as an artist, sometimes a fan, sometimes a star, she investigates the fascination between celebrities and their audience. She recently presented her work at the Museum of Contemporary Art in Lyon or Do Disturb! at the Palais de Tokyo in Paris.
